Job Description:

The Sarah Lawrence College Dance/Movement Therapy Program is seeking Guest Faculty to teach semester-long courses in Movement Observation and Theory and Practice over the 2021-2022 academic year. Candidates interested in teaching one or more courses are encouraged to apply.
The Dance/Movement Therapy Program is committed to providing mentoring to support racial and cultural diversity within the program. We encourage candidates who may otherwise meet the professional qualifications but lack teaching experience to apply with an understanding that teaching support will be provided. Candidates interested in learning more about the program may wish to visit our website at https://www.sarahlawrence.edu/dance-movement-therapy/

Required Qualifications:

Candidates should have a minimum of two years of full-time clinical experience in dance/movement therapy or the part-time equivalent and the BC-DMT credential.
Candidates for the Movement Observation class should also have documented evidence of significant additional and advanced movement observation training (not Laban) or certification in a movement analysis system.

Organization

Sarah Lawrence is a prestigious, residential, coeducational liberal arts college. Founded in 1926 and consistently ranked among the leading liberal arts colleges in the country, Sarah Lawrence is known for its pioneering approach to education, rich history of impassioned intellectual and civic engagement, and vibrant, successful alumni. In close proximity to the unparalleled offerings of New York City, our historic campus is home to an inclusive, intellectually curious, and diverse community.

Talented, creative students choose Sarah Lawrence for the opportunity to take charge of their education. In close collaboration with our dedicated, distinguished faculty, students create a rigorous, personalized course of study, conduct independent research, and connect a wide array of disciplines. They graduate knowing how to apply the knowledge, skills, and critical thinking necessary for life after college.

Sarah Lawrence College occupies 44 wooded acres in Yonkers, NY, near the Village of Bronxville—just north of New York City. A 30-minute train ride from the Bronxville station takes students into Midtown Manhattan.

In addition to our round-table classrooms, Sarah Lawrence has outstanding theatres, art and performance studios, and music spaces; modern science labs; state-of-the-art graphic computing equipment; competitive sports facilities; a 60,000-square-foot visual arts center; and recently renovated dining facilities.

Our students are men and women who share an enthusiasm for intellectual rigor, academic risk taking, creativity in all disciplines, and original and interdisciplinary work. We are particularly committed to having our faculty, administration, and student body reflect the social, racial, and economic diversity that characterizes our society. The College’s 1,377 undergraduate students come from nearly every state and from 53 countries; 84 percent of undergrads live on campus.

At Sarah Lawrence, students spend more time one-on-one with award-winning faculty than do students at any other college in the country.
